High-throughput Scanning with Single-molecule Sensitivity and Diffraction Limited Resolution

    We present a fluorescence readout system for ultra-sensitive high-throughput scanning. The system is based on a technology that for the first time allows scanning of square centimeter areas with single molecule sensitivity and diffraction limited resolution within minutes. The novel detection technology can be applied to ultra-sensitive live cell screening, slide based cytometry, microarray readout and readout of bead-assays. The ultra-sensitivity will allow for revealing information not accessible with currently available detection strategies.
